Description: London; New York, Michael Joseph; Hutchinson; Grafton; Jonathan Cape; HarperCollins, 1968-1994 . First edition. Hardback. Seven volumes of works by Len Deighton. Including five novels, and his non-fiction study of the Second World War. Len Deighton is known for his novels, works of military history, and screenplays. His first novel, The IPCRESS File, was published in 1962, and was an enormous critical and commercial success.In chronological order of publication, present in this set is:The 1968 first edition of 'Len Deighton's Continental Dossier: A Collection of Cultural, Culinary, Historical, Spooky, Grim and Preposterous Fact&apos. Compiled with the aid of Deighton's school friends Victor and Margaret Pettitt, this work is a fascinating guide to continental European driving tours in the late '60s. Illustrated throughout, and with a folding map to the rear.The first editions, first impressions of 'Mexico Set', and 'London Match', novels in the Bernard Samson series, published in 1984 and 1985 respectively, both in the publisher's original unclipped dust wrappers.The 1987 silver jubilee edition of Deighton's Harry Palmer novel 'Twinkle, Twinkle, Little Spy', published to celebrate the twenty-fifth anniversary of the publication of The IPCRESS File.The first edition, first impression of the 1993 historical study 'Blood, Tears & Folly: In The Darkest Hour Of The Second World War', in the publisher's original unclipped dust wrapper.The 1993 first USĀ edition, first impression of 'Violent Ward', in the publisher's original unclipped dust wrapper.And finally, the 1994 first edition, first impression of the novel 'Faith', in the publisher's original unclipped dust wrapper. With five volumes in the publisher's original cloth bindings with unclipped dust wrappers, one volume in the publisher's paper wraps, and a final volume in the publisher's original pictorial paper boards. Sunning to Continental Dossier and back strip, with boards exceptionally bright. Shelf wear to Twinkle Twinkle back strip head and tail. Bumping to London Match spine head and tail. Violent Ward and Blood, Tears & Folly dust wrappers worn to back strip heads and tails, with light sunning to back strips of London Match and Blood back strips. Internally, firmly bound. Pages clean and bright, with Twinkle, Twinkle lightly age toned to perimeters. Near Fine . Ill.: Not Stated. Near Fine/Near Fine.
